Analysis

The most recent figure for emissions from crops — emissions (co2eq) from n2o, per capita in Cuba is 0 kt per person, measured in 2023. That is the lowest value across all 63 years on record.

Compared with earlier readings it is down 49.1% on the previous year and down 87.4% over ten years.

Over the whole period, emissions from crops — emissions (co2eq) from n2o, per capita in Cuba peaked at 0.0002 kt per person in 1989 and was at its lowest, 0 kt per person, in 2023.

Cuba ranks 141st of 176 countries on this measure, in the bottom quarter.

The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ated

Emissions from crops — Emissions (CO2eq) from N2O (AR5) divided by Population, total, mat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.

Emissions from crops — Emissions (CO2eq) from N2O (AR5) ÷ Population, total
